My first tip is the time of year that you go. You have probably heard of how horrible the crowds can be in the summer or during the holidays at Disney World, and those horror stories are true. Lines in the Orlando heat with millions of children just simply isn’t my idea of a dream vacation so I always suggest to travel during the off months. Of course that isn’t always possible, but if you can do it, I highly suggest it not just for your wallet, but for your nerves as well. September and May are the times of year I most often suggest. They are milder in temperatures….although September is still warm…you can back that up to October which is also just as nice, just not Halloween, again, think crowds. These times of the year are not only less crowded (I’ve never experienced wait times for rides in these months), but they are also less expensive.

My second tip for planning this incredible vacation, which I assure that you will adore as much as the kiddo’s will, is to stay On Site with Disney Resorts. You will save by doing this in many ways, especially when you go during the off season. When you stay on-site you will have access to all of Disney’s transportation to and from each resort, each park, each water park, and Downtown Disney. This is a huge savings in itself when you calculate the money saved on parking fees alone. Add to the savings the time that you will save by using the monorail system, busses, and even boats throughout the parks. Instead of spending time in traffic burning your own gas you will be you’re your family enjoying the time together and taking in the sights. Your kids will LOVE it, especially the monorail. When you book your stay ask about Disney Dining deals! This is so important because throughout the year they offer various discounts, at times even offering FREE DINING which I highly suggest taking advantage of for sure! There are several dining plans to look into, but what you want to look for is the time that they are offering the Standard Plus Dining Plan for FREE! What does this mean? This dining plan includes 1 counter-service meal credit, 1 table-service meal credit, and 1 snack credit per person, per night of stay. Receiving this dining plan free of charge saves a family of four about $107 per night of stay, based on the regular cost of this dining plan. This is a huge savings over a week’s vacation. You can upgrade to the Deluxe dining plan and just pay the difference between the standard and the deluxe plans. When you look at the various restaurants that Disney offers, please look beyond the counter service meals which really do leave much to be desired and look at the character meals, dinner shows, dining events, and fine/signature dining.
